Transaction 8ee49c654a38bc419f6e006f16282d63adbaefe73e1087eef4940ba6d9705fbb

69 Input
1 Outputs
  • 8ee49c654a38bc419f6e006f16282d63adbaefe73e1087eef4940ba6d9705fbb:0
  • value  9807588
    address  35hctvSEyKdbkHuFp1fuoYbr844oyDZ5Qq